一、以太坊钱包授权查询的基本理解

以太坊作为一个开源的区块链平台,允许用户创建和管理数字资产,进行智能合约的运行。在这些功能中,钱包的授权管理尤为重要。授权是指用户对其数字资产所拥有的权限,特别是在与去中心化应用(DApp)或交易所交互时,用户需要通过授权来确保自己的资产安全。

在以太坊网络中,用户可以通过钱包发送、接收和管理其以太币(ETH)及其他基于以太坊的代币(如ERC-20代币)。当用户需要向某个智能合约提供权限进行代币转移时,就需要进行授权。用户在此过程中的做法及其后果,正是我们今天要讨论的主题。

二、为什么需要授权查询


如何查询以太坊钱包的授权:步骤与技巧

用户需要查询授权的主要原因是为了确保自己的资产安全。在区块链的世界中,钱包里存放的数字资产是非常宝贵的。每一次对某个智能合约的授权,都意味着用户允许该合约以用户的名义对其资产进行操作。若用户未能妥善管理这些授权,就可能面临资产被盗或者丢失的风险。

因此,定期查询授权是保护用户资产的好习惯。通过了解哪些合约被授权访问自己的资产,用户可以做出相应的反应,比如撤销未被使用的授权,降低安全风险。

三、如何查询以太坊钱包的授权

查询以太坊钱包的授权有几种方法,用户可以根据自己的需求选择合适的工具和步骤。

1. 使用以太坊区块链浏览器

以太坊区块链浏览器是一个强大的工具,可以提供区块链上所有交易和智能合约的透明信息。用户只需要知道自己钱包的地址,就可以通过以下步骤查询授权:

  • 访问以太坊区块链浏览器网站,如Etherscan.io或Etherchain.org。
  • 在搜索框中输入以太坊钱包地址并进行搜索。
  • 查看钱包的交易记录,查找与智能合约交互的记录,特别是“Approve”或“Transfer”类型的交易。

这样,用户便可以看到授权的状态,确定哪些代币被授权给了哪些合约。

2. 使用钱包软件或工具

许多以太坊钱包软件如MetaMask等,都内置了有关授权的查询功能。用户只需在钱包中找到相关的授权管理选项,便可以轻松查看所有授权的合约和已授权的代币数量。

  • 打开钱包应用,并登录你的账户。
  • 找到“授权”或“权限”的选项。
  • 在此页面中查看所有授予的智能合约访问权限。

如果有不需要的授权,用户可以在此处选择撤销,不需要再去区块链浏览器一一查找。

3. 利用去中心化应用(DApp)

一些去中心化应用(如DeFi平台)提供了有关授权的查询和管理工具。这些DApp通常会连接到用户的钱包,实时显示当前的授权状态。操作步骤一般如下:

  • 访问你选择的DApp,确保钱包已连接。
  • 在DApp的设置中找到授权管理部分。
  • 查看已授权的合约并决定是否需要撤销。

四、如何撤销不必要的授权


如何查询以太坊钱包的授权:步骤与技巧

撤销不必要的授权是确保数字资产安全的重要一步。如果发现了某些不活跃的或可疑的授权记录,用户应及时进行撤销。

1. 使用区块链浏览器撤销授权

用户可以通过以太坊区块链浏览器直接发送撤销授权的交易。一般步骤为:

  • 找到目标智能合约的地址。
  • 选择需要撤销的授权记录,并获取其合约函数签名。通常,撤销方法是通过调用合约的“Approve”函数,将值设为0。
  • 在钱包中发送一笔“Approve”交易,参数为智能合约地址和0。

2. 使用钱包软件撤销授权

多数以太坊钱包如MetaMask,会提供简单的步骤供用户撤销授权:

  • 打开钱包应用并登录。
  • 进入授权管理界面。
  • 选择需要撤销的合约,点击撤销按钮,确认交易。

五、授权查询的潜在风险与注意事项

查询与管理授权同样伴随一些潜在风险。用户在进行授权时,需小心选择应用与合约,确保它们的可信度。此外,在使用区块链浏览器查询时,用户应注意防范钓鱼网站,确保输入信息正确。

此外,用户需要确保自己了解每个合约的功能及其与用户资产的关系,在进行授权时需谨慎,防止出现资产被盗或丢失的情况。

总结

查询以太坊钱包的授权是保护数字资产安全的重要步骤。通过区块链浏览器、钱包软件和去中心化应用,用户能够方便地进行授权查询和管理。定期检查和清理不必要的授权,能够帮助用户更好地掌握自己的数字资产,从而在这个快速变化的区块链世界中保持主动权。

相关问题与解答

1. 如何保护以太坊钱包免受未授权访问?

保护以太坊钱包的方式有很多,包括但不限于使用强密码及双重认证。不随意点击陌生链接,定期检查授权,以确保钱包中的数字资产安全。

2. 在授权管理中,哪些合约是可以信任的?

通常来说,主流的DeFi平台、钱包及应用都比较可信,但用户依然需要做一些研究,查看合约的开源实现以及用户反馈,以确保授权合约的安全性。

3. 撤销授权后,资产会受到什么影响?

撤销授权后,智能合约将不再能够访问授权的资产,因此,用户必须在需要继续与合约交互时重新授权,这可能会影响用户在某些应用中的操作能力。

4. 以太坊钱包的授予与撤销授权的费用需要多少?

在以太坊上进行授权与撤销授权的交易都会产生一定的“Gas费”,具体费用与网络的拥堵程度有关,用户可以通过当前网络情况估算费用。

5. 如果发现授权合约被恶意篡改,该如何处理?

首先,用户应立即撤销该合约的所有授权,防止进一步的资产损失。接着,尽快转移资产到新创建的钱包中,以保护资产安全。此外,应深入调查该合约的情况,并警告其他用户。

这篇文章涵盖了如何查询和管理以太坊钱包的授权,以及相关的安全措施和注意事项。希望能为你的资产安全提供有效的帮助。